## 0.14.2 — Changed defaults

Fixed the websocket reconnect loop in Tindervane Relay. Previously, dropped connections retried with no backoff cap, hammering the gateway and tripping rate limits for plugin sessions. Reconnect now uses capped exponential backoff with jitter, and the default max attempts dropped from unlimited to 12. Plugins relying on infinite retries must handle the new `reconnect_exhausted` event. No API changes otherwise. The new defaults shipped to all regions are as follows.

settings of kajep-kawip:
[zorys]
host = zorys.urlaqgrid.corp
user = zorys_svc
database = zorys_prod

Subject: SDK parity cut-over — we made it

Hey folks, quick wrap-up: as of last night the Larkspur mobile SDK is at full feature parity with the desktop SDK, so the compatibility shim is retired. Customers on the old shim get a deprecation banner for two more releases, then hard errors. If anyone asks what the parity gateway is actually enforcing now, the live settings are as follows.

service settings:
novath:
  pin: 1396
  tenant: pelys
  seal: seal_ccc035e1
  metrics_host: metrics.novath.qorvelworks.test
  standby_team: fraeth
  escalation: drueth-zorok
  nonce: 61d508

Subject: Handover of the Quillmark rendering pipeline

Team,

As of next sprint, ownership of the Quillmark markdown rendering pipeline is changing. This covers the parser extensions, the sanitizer stage, and the nightly regression suite that diffs rendered output against golden files. Please route all review requests and incident escalations accordingly, and note that the legacy footnote shim is slated for removal in Q3 — do not build on it. Future maintainers should consult the runbook before touching the sanitizer. The new owner is:

named custodian: Brivan Eliath Quenox Frador

Ticket: Dedupe service (Klaxonfold) failing auth against the paging gateway since Tuesday. Root cause: service credential expired; nobody owns rotation. Alerts are now double-firing on every incident. Short-term fix: rotate the key, restart the klaxonfold-worker pods, confirm dedupe counters resume. Long-term: add rotation to the quarterly checklist. For the restart, use the key below.

gateway credential: kto23_LX9A4ys6i4nzHtpOLNLodKK